In the past, BPOs were seen as helpers for simple jobs like entering data, paying employees, and answering customer questions. The main reason businesses used them was to save money by doing non-essential tasks cheaper. But today, BPOs do much more. They help manage whole processes, use advanced tools, and even help make money. By bringing in specialized skills, technology, and structure, BPOs help businesses handle complex tasks and find new growth chances.

For example, a study by Deloitte from 2025 found that 65% of companies worldwide said their outsourcing partners helped grow the business, not just save money.This shows that BPOs are moving from just helping with everyday tasks to being important partners in making business decisions and achieving results.

Scalability helps when businesses grow quickly

A big advantage of modern BPOs is being able to grow quickly. When companies grow fast, their internal teams can get too busy, causing mistakes, delays, and missed opportunities. BPO providers offer flexible support so companies can scale up or down based on need. For example, an e-commerce company had trouble handling a big rush of orders. By outsourcing, they were able to:

– Increase their workforce by three times during busy times

– Keep service quality high without extra cost

– Avoid paying for long-term costs

With this flexibility, companies can act fast when opportunities come up without being limited by their own resources.

Using technology and new ways to work better

Modern BPOs use smart tools and technology that can be expensive or hard to set up in-house. These include AI to automate workflows and real-time dashboards for tracking performance. A financial firm used a BPO provider to handle loan processes and customer interactions. The BPO introduced AI tools that made things better:

– Made the process faster by 35%

– Reduced errors by 25%

– Helped the firm get more customers, making more money

By using technology and better ways to work, BPOs help companies be more efficient and focus their own resources on new ideas and growth strategies.

Making better decisions with data

One of the main benefits of BPOs today is their ability to provide useful information. By looking at how things are going, BPOs can spot problems, predict future needs, and suggest improvements. A logistics company outsourced tracking and customer help to a BPO. Using data from their operations, the BPO:

– Found that shipments were often delayed

– Improved how they planned routes and communicated with customers

– Reduced delays by 18% and improved customer satisfaction by 22%

This kind of data helps companies make better choices, improve their services, and grow their business.
